WHAT DOES HYDROXONIUM M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Hydronium

The hydronium cation, also known as hydroxonium is the positively charged polyatomic ion with the chemical formula H 3O+. Hydronium, a type of oxonium ion, is formed by the protonation of water. This cation is often used to represent the nature of the proton in aqueous solution, where the proton is highly solvated. The reality is far more complicated, as a proton is bound to several molecules of water, such that other descriptions such as H5O2+, H7O3+ and H9O4+ are increasingly accurate descriptions of the environment of a proton in water. The ion H 3O+ has been detected in the gas phase.
